<p>The gangster / jazz great look is a hard one to pull off with any measure of success. Too often practitioners err with exaggeratedly-cut or outlandishly-fabric&#8217;d suits, overly large or oddly-hued hats, ridiculous neckties, or just generally odious accessories and embellishments. The trick is to keep things as elegantly simple and classic as possible, perhaps even a little austere if you really don&#8217;t want anyone thinking you&#8217;re on your way to a costume ball. </p>

<p>Actor and musician <a href="http://imdb.com/name/nm0005024/">Terrence Howard</a> obviously understands this principle perfectly. The other night at the premiere of a new <a href="http://www.reuters.com/article/stageNews/idUSN1156840020071212">Broadway production</a> of Tennessee Williams&#8217; <em>Cat on a Hot Tin Roof</em> that he&#8217;s starring in, Howard shone in two pieces of a three-piece black pinstriped suit, a generously-cuffed and collared white dress shirt, a black silk pindot tie, and a classic black fedora, all custom-made by Californian bespoke tailor David Heil of <a href="http://www.davidaugustinc.com/">David August</a>. It was dramatic without being theatrical, an important distinction for any aspiring MOTH to master.</p>

<p>Mashups of high and low fashion will always have a certain high-concept appeal, but it shouldn&#8217;t stop us from distinguishing between a <a href="/good-idea/">good idea</a> and a <a href="/bad-idea/">bad idea</a>. And <a href="http://www.rakuten.co.jp/ltd-online/457516/855361/">high-top wingtips</a> are certainly the latter. Luckily, like pachinko and monster attacks, these unfortunate creations are currently confined to Japan, where they will hopefully remain. (We&#8217;re looking at you, <a href="http://www.kanyeuniversecity.com/blog/">Kanye</a>.)</p>

<p>The problem isn&#8217;t just the spaceman look of the sneaker half. This is the rare mashup that manages to degrade both sides of the equation. Wearing them in place of actual wingtips would be unthinkable, but they&#8217;re too jarring to work as sneakers either. It&#8217;s hard to imagine even the most die-hard sneakerheads putting in the necessary time and care to keep the tips properly polished and oiled. After that, you&#8217;re left with something that&#8217;s more idea than shoe.</p>

<p>The prevalence of the Sleek Grey Suit among men of style these days is aesthetically appealing but not terribly interesting, sartorially speaking. But here comes <a href="http://imdb.com/name/nm0001804/">Stanley Tucci</a> to show us how it should be done. </p>

<p>Tucci, the acclaimed actor (and also writer, producer and director) who currently has seven different movies in production, elevated the SGS to a whole new level with the simple addition of a dashing, brilliantly hued scarf. </p>

<p>Overpowering with most other outfits, it was the perfect topnote to the SGS by <a href="http://hugoboss.com/">Hugo Boss</a> Tucci wore the other night to the premiere of <a href="http://imdb.com/title/tt0804505/"><em>Married Life</em></a>, hosted by <a href="/scene/kempt-moth-andrew-saffir.php">fellow MOTH</a> Andrew Saffir&#8217;s Cinema Society and designer <a href="http://www.nicolemiller.com/">Nicole Miller</a>. The classic specs insouciantly hanging off the breast pocket are a nice touch too. </p>

<p>All we were able to discover about the scarf&#8217;s provenance is that Tucci purchased it at a small boutique in Belgium, but if you&#8217;re looking for something similar we suggest a trip to <a href="http://www.etro.com/">Etro</a>. It won&#8217;t turn you into Tucci, but it&#8217;ll help your suit out no end. </p>

<p>The style arbiters at the New York Times&#8217; T Magazine <a href="http://themoment.blogs.nytimes.com/2008/03/07/a-style-salute-william-f-buckley-jr/">have revealed</a> what was behind the artful dishevelment of recently deceased pundit William F. Buckley Jr.: dressing up was simply beneath him. </p>

<p>Buckley adopted the blueblood uniform of The Millbrook School, the sort of upper crusty institution where <a href="http://www.mensflair.com/style-advice/the-roots-of-american-preppy.php">the preppy look was born</a> back in the day, they write, and never grew out of it. </p>

<p>&#8220;He came from an era and background where if you looked like you spent too much time thinking about clothes, then everything else was suspect,&#8221; the great <a href="http://www.alanflussercustom.com/index2.html">Alan Flusser</a> tells T. &#8220;[He was] anti-fashion in the original sense of the term.&#8221; Hence the moth-eaten Shetland sweaters. Buckley himself <a href="http://article.nationalreview.com/?q=Mjc2ODYyNDExMmM0YzE1MjNjOGFlZDFjMTZmZjM0ZmY=">once wrote</a> that if left alone he would &#8220;permit [my] standards of personal dress to deteriorate to the level of the downright offensive.&#8221;</p>

<p>While the homage was no doubt unintentional, Preppy style was once again back in <a href="http://www.dnrnews.com/site/article.php?id=1493">full force</a> at the recent Premiere Vision menswear trade show. And so Buckley&#8217;s style lives on in the form of thousands of pastel-hued polo shirts.</p>

<p>The restaurants bearing the <a href="http://www.mrchow.com/">Mr. Chow</a> moniker are known as much for their <em>haute-chinois</em> cuisine and glittering clientele as their sophisticated, understated elegance. Small wonder then that the real Mr. Chow embodies the latter perfectly. </p>

<p>We&#8217;ve never had the pleasure of dining at the original London location, opened in 1968, but the super-stylish <a href="http://www.mrchow.com/therestaurants/fiftyseven/">New York outpost</a> on E. 57th St. is one of our favorite restaurants in the world. The man behind it all, Michael Chow, is also an <a href="http://imdb.com/name/nm0159485/">actor</a> of note and an art collector <em>extraordinaire</em> whose portrait has been painted by David Hockney and Jean-Michel Basquiat, among others. </p>

<p>The other night at his Beverly Hills branch, Chow hosted a party for <a href="/scene/kempt-moth-julian-shnabel.php">Julian Schnabel</a> following his opening at the Gagosian Gallery. He looked smashing in his trademark <a href="http://www.cutlerandgross.com/">Cutler &amp; Gross</a> specs and a bespoke three-piece black pinstripe suit with a ticket pocket, white dress shirt, and solid blue silk tie, all custom-ordered from <a href="http://www.hermes.com">Hermes</a>. And he was cleverly shod to boot - by bespoke bootmaker <a href="http://www.gjcleverley.co.uk/">George Cleverly</a> of London, that is. </p>

<p>From <a href="http://www.imdb.com/title/tt0058182/">Hard Day&#8217;s Night</a> to <a href="http://www.bbc.co.uk/totp/">Top of the Pops</a> (R.I.P.), the Brits have always had a knack for filming music. Their <a href="http://music.guardian.co.uk/pop/story/0,,2261333,00.html">latest good idea</a> is the <a href="http://www.blackcabsessions.com">Black Cab Sessions</a>, a web video series filmed from the back of a London cab.</p>

<p>The pay for the gig is the price of a cab ride, flagged down on the day of the shoot. The cabbie introduces the band, or often enough, just the frontman. (The cab&#8217;s aren&#8217;t big, after all.) The songs are all recorded in one take, usually on the way from the hotel to the venue, so the sessions have an immediacy and intimacy that&#8217;s increasingly rare in music. The camera periodically pans across the street for a little incidental London scenery, just so you don&#8217;t forget where you are.</p>

<p>The rides themselves vary, from the Raveonettes&#8217; <a href="http://www.blackcabsessions.com/sessions.php?id=1196703238&amp;sort=chronological">gridlocked session</a> to the National&#8217;s <a href="http://www.blackcabsessions.com/sessions.php?id=1194804299&amp;sort=chronological">long dark cab ride home</a>. Bill Callahan (also known as Smog) gets a little <a href="http://www.blackcabsessions.com/sessions.php?id=1191422055&amp;sort=chronological">unintended accompaniment</a> from passing cars, but it only adds to the urban ambience. Spoon&#8217;s Britt Daniel is <a href="http://www.blackcabsessions.com/sessions.php?id=1204277632&amp;sort=chronological">effortlessly perfect</a> as always (and still rocking the Ray-Bans) while Okkervil River&#8217;s Will Sheff turns in a <a href="http://www.blackcabsessions.com/sessions.php?id=1200646881&amp;sort=chronological">harmonica-assisted version</a> of Big Star&#8217;s &#8220;Big Black Car.&#8221;</p>

<p>In his capacity as a graphic design demigod, <a href="http://www.goodisdead.com/">Chip Kidd</a> routinely transforms books into <em>objets d&#8217;art</em>. In the course of a celebrated career he&#8217;s done <a href="http://www.amazon.com/Chip-Kidd-Book-Work-1986-2006/dp/0847827852/ref=pd_bbs_sr_1?ie=UTF8&amp;s=books&amp;qid=1204556681&amp;sr=1-1">dazzling dustjackets</a> for everyone from <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/John_Updike">John Updike</a> to <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bret_easton_ellis">Bret Easton Ellis</a>. Some of his work, like the famous dinosaur skeleton he designed for Michael Crichton&#8217;s <a href="http://imdb.com/title/tt0107290/"><em>Jurassic Park</em></a>, even takes on a life of its own. </p>

<p>Kidd, an accomplished author as well, also cuts quite a figure when he&#8217;s out on the town, as evidenced by this snap from the fete for his latest novel, <a href="http://www.amazon.com/Learners-Novel-Chip-Kidd/dp/0743255240/ref=pd_sim_b_img_2"><em>The Learners</em></a>. He&#8217;s sporting a <em>café-au-lait</em> colored wool tone-on-tone stripe suit by <a href="http://www.brioni.com/">Brioni</a>, a blue and white striped shirt with a contrasting &#8220;club&#8221; collar from <a href="http://getkempt.com/tag/ralphlauren">Ralph Lauren</a>, and a solid blue silk tie ditto. His trademark vintage-style specs were custom-ordered from <a href="http://angloamericanopticalltd.com/index.html">Anglo American Optical</a>&mdash;the MOTH-as-aesthete&#8217;s choice. </p>

<p>We&#8217;ve been waiting for the second coming of the cummerbund, but we didn&#8217;t think it would look like this. </p>

<p>This Japanese belly warmer, called a <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Haramaki">haramaki</a>, is threatening to go mainstream. Adapted from a piece of samurai armor, the midriff scarf&#8217;s popularity is currently limited to <a href="http://www.motorcycle-superstore.com/2/6/10/9589/ITEM/Fox-Racing-Blackbelt-Kidney-Belt-.aspx">bikers</a>, <a href="http://www.backcountry.com/store/RED0077/Red-Impact-Kidney-Belt.html">skiers</a> and <a href="http://www.rakuten.co.jp/phild-life/460169/580416/">the pregnant</a>. While that may not seem like fertile crossover territory, it hasn&#8217;t stopped the garment from <a href="http://www.neatorama.com/2008/02/28/haramaki/">making waves</a> online as the <a href="http://www.pingmag.jp/2007/01/15/haramaki-a-granny-item-made-fashionable/">next big thing</a> in layering.</p>

<p>We can easily picture it on a runway, but we offer the following request: Please, please restrain yourselves.</p>
